About

Pitt Solar is a proposed 80 MW solar generation project located in Pitt County, North Carolina. The project is in the PJM interconnection queue as entry PJM-AC1-189, with a queue entry date of October 31, 2016. The proposed commercial operation date is November 17, 2026, and the interconnection agreement has been executed. Dominion is the listed utility.
